Wilmington has a needle exchange program to help heroin users
WILMINGTON, NC (StarNews) — Crouched on the edge of Market Street, Mike Page is paying no attention to the cars zooming past over his left shoulder.
His eyes are locked on the face of the too-skinny woman in the camisole slumped against a telephone pole. She has a grocery bag filled with candy bars at her feet, which Page takes at a sign that she’s using drugs.
After a few minutes, Page returns to a mini-van waiting nearby. The girl doesn’t want overdose antidote naloxone or syringes, but she will take the condoms the group is offering.
